In a world where perfection is so often obsessed over, many parents have been led to believe that to obtain "perfected" versions of themselves or their children is in vogue. At the moment, only privileged officials or advanced science corporations have been able to obtain this status. The large production of "perfect clones" has resulted in a generation of cast out "imperfect children."
Each Perfect Child is different. They have been more/less accepted into society, some with greater acceptance than their originals. They assume themselves to be their own people, and generally want to keep living and keep their newly assumed position.
Imperfect Children have become very unpopular. Because of this, people who can't afford them or can't obtain them may pressure their imperfect children to perfect themselves. Those I.C. that have been cast out wander the streets alone, or join in groups, planning to someday regain their places in life.

Imperfect Children and their doubles may only be doubles in origin-- they don't have to look alike. Sometimes they are too difficult to tell apart, sometimes the difference is more obvious.

So here's the game.

You either create [1] One character and his/her perfect double, or [2] A supporting character (or more of those). Any significant people in their lives that need to be noted should be included in the bio. Try to be complete, as these profiles are very important for your roles in this RP smile

Creating more than one of these sets is totally fine.
Also, from here onward, the official term for the clones/copies/perfectversion/etc. will be Doubles. So people creating a pair will be creating the Original and the Double.



All acting characters should be human. Mutants do exist in this world, but only as a result of scientific experiments- they are not mythical creatures. Magical abilities are not encouraged!
Keep in mind that the meaning of the word "perfect" is different for everyone-- or can be, so be creative as possible!

"We warned you," Phyllis's mother spoke stiffly, her eyes never leaving the television screen. "We can't tolerate your misbehavior anymore. From now on, this girl is our Phyllis Lane."
The woman turned to the other girl- that girl who looked exactly like her- and her voice became infused with warmth and familiarity. "Come here, Phyl-darling. We need to chat about what's to be done about your room. It's too much full of that music stuff- I'll have it cleaned up nicely for you so you can fully concentrate on your homework..."

"Hey! Is Phyllis here now? I need to ask her about a question I need answered for my schoolwork!" Phyllis's brother yelled, running down the stairs.

Phyllis turned to answer him, but froze as he excitedly ran past her and to her Double. Her father quietly approached behind him and sat beside his wife and son showering affection over the other Phyllis. They had quietly excluded her from their lives. This was the final straw. Still somewhat numb with disbelief, she turned and walked out of the house for the last time.

-----------------------------------------------

"Jam" Phyllis Lane knew nothing about this whole Original-Double business- all she cared about was making her family happy. She aced her tests, and did well in school, did them proud- and they gave her their love. But at times she wondered about what had happened to the other Phyllis. That day, the other girl had walked out and had never been seen again. Jam had begun to attend university in Phyllis's place, but had never seen her around. She'd either quit, or enrolled in another school. Replacing Phyllis had been easy. The company that sponsored Phyllis's releases even took more of a liking to her- she had the same voice as Phyllis did, and was much easier to work with.

Sometimes she worried about whether Phyllis would one day come back and try to reclaim her place.

But- as an afterthought, seeing how Phyllis was as weak-willed as she was, she probably wouldn't try something so rash, Jam reasoned. They'd probably never meet again. As long as she still had Phyllis's (now Jam's) family, she was sure her own happiness would be guaranteed. Nothing could ruin it.

"Good morning, sir! How was your morning? Are you heading to the office? May I help you with anything?"

"Thank you, Mr. Cawley. My morning was great. I'm off to the office now, and I won't need any help, thank you. I'll see you later!"

Lewis fought to keep his smile from crooking awkwardly as he walked past his employees in the hallway. He had to keep up appearances, after all! Since the establishment of the company (one year ago), he still couldn't get used to having men and women much older than him addressing him as "sir" or "boss." But he'd already become accustomed to running the Doubles-production business- already his company was considered to be one of the most successful in that industry.

"Mr. Lewis! Thank you so much for letting us create my daughter's Double! Phyllis is much more tolerable now. I feel like all our family problems have been solved."

Lewis smiled wider. "That's what Doubles are for, Mr. Lane. Don't thank me-- it's all I could do to repay you and your wife's work."

If he could fill the world with Doubles, he would- but not because he had a grand scheme to perfect every single being in society- (he was aware that the concept behind using a Double was very flawed)- it was because of the fame and money it would bring. The more he sold, and the more his company grew, Lewis's name would rise in society.

Lewis was one of the few first to create a "perfect" clone- a double of a human. The prodigy son of a prodigal scientist mother, he graduated college early and played a major role in running his mother's research company, which specialized in genetic engineering and cloning. As time went on, his mother became jealous of his talent, which seemed to surpass hers by the day, and constantly gave him a hard time both in the home and at the company. She seemed to decide that harsh words weren't enough to prove her points, and turned to physical harm. Eventually, Lewis left the house- and she let him leave, thinking that he wouldn't be able to progress without the advantage of using her resources. She was sorely mistaken. Lewis opened his own business, and through some old connections he expanded it to be on par with his mother's company, eventually creating a Double of his mother.

That he had considered replacing his mother and actually gone through with it had been widely discussed and criticized by many acquaintances- but it was an irrefutable fact that many of them had also dreamt of a world where flawed people could simply be vanished from society by creating the more agreeable Doubles to act in their places. There were many who believed perfection was the ultimate goal. Uncooperative people were smudges on their clean slates. Those people who commissioned Doubles were the models of society. These beliefs, and more, propelled people to invest in his business, and helped it flourish.

In due time, Lewis would realize that the happiness in his life was but a fragile dream.
